Three journalists receive IRE's 2022 Freelance Fellowship

Published: February 10, 2023 | Written by: Anna Lopez
IRE is pleased to announce that Britta Lokting, Jonathan Moens and Gregor Stuart Hunter are the recipients of our 2022 Freelance Fellowships. With IRE’s support, these independent journalists will pursue projects investigating disability issues, technology, and China’s offshore wealth.

Three journalists receive IRE's 2023 Journalist of Color Investigative Reporting Fellowship

Published: February 1, 2023 | Written by: Anna Lopez
Halima Gikandi of The World, Leslie Rangel of KTBC-TV, Austin and Kaylee Tornay of InvestigateWest will serve as IRE’s 2023 Journalists of Color Investigative Reporting Fellows.
